原文:redis利用key計時與計數

計時 Setex 命令為指定的 key 設置值及其過期時間。如果 key 已經存在, SETEX 命令將會替換舊的值 基本命令: redis . . . : gt SETEX KEY NAME TIMEOUT VALUE 例子: 當set進值后,開始計時, 使用TTL查看剩余時間,在剩余時間內,使用get key 獲取值 計數 Hsetnx 命令用於為哈希表中不存在的的字段賦值 如果哈希表不存在, ...

2017-06-20 17:04 0 3114 推薦指數:

查看詳情

利用python腳本統計和刪除redis key

該腳本掃描redis中所有的key,用於分析redis內存數據的key構成,掃描並保存文件,需要python支持redis模塊。 刪除key 提前把key保存到key.txt文件中,然后讀取一行一行執行刪除key的動作。 ...

Thu Oct 22 22:24:00 CST 2020 1 1784
Rediskey的設計與管理(利用枚舉)

一、rediskey 設計原則 唯一、可讀、靈活、失效 唯一,比如注冊驗證碼,需要加上 register_verify_code 作為唯一標識 可讀,見名知意 靈活,比如攻略文章點贊的設計,可以帶上用戶id,攻略文章id,strategy_thumbsupnum_vo ...

Fri Aug 20 22:50:00 CST 2021 0 97
如何利用redis key過期事件實現過期提醒

https://blog.csdn.net/zhu_tianwei/article/details/80169900 redis自2.8.0之后版本提供Keyspace Notifications功能,允許客戶訂閱Pub / Sub頻道,以便以某種方式接收影響Redis數據集的事件 ...

Tue Mar 05 18:58:00 CST 2019 0 5031
Redis的大key

rediskey和value的最大上限是512M 當key大於10k時,稱得上是大key 1byte = 8bit 1k = 1024byte 1M = 1024k 1G = 1024M bit = 字節 一個漢字占2個bit,一個英文(不區分大小寫)占1bit,中文標點占 ...

Tue Sep 07 23:40:00 CST 2021 0 100
C# 計時器和計數

定義:System.Threading.Timer timer;int count;TextBox textBox1; 創建計時器和每秒要執行的方法:timer = new System.Threading.Timer(st =>{ ++count; textBox1.AppendText ...

Mon Jan 13 22:41:00 CST 2020 0 698
利用CSS計數函數counter()實現計數

要實現li列表計數比較簡單,直接設置list-style-type即可,但是要實現非li列表計數該怎么辦呢,counter()可以輕松實現 body{counter-reset:section 0 subsec 1; //插入計數器,第一個計數器從0開始累加,第二個計數器從1開始累加 ...

Thu Oct 20 05:33:00 CST 2016 0 1608
redis實現計數--------Redis increment

  經理提出新的需求,需要知道每天微信推送了多少條模板消息,成功多少條,失敗多少條,想到用Redis緩存,網上查了一些資料,Redis中有方法increment,測試代碼如下    Controller Service 直接使用ops.get ...

Fri Aug 10 23:15:00 CST 2018 0 20741
新浪計數業務之Redis

今天聽一個同事說新浪使用的是Redis,於是自己將研究的過程整理出來以備后用。 我們都知道微博這玩意兒現在很火,新浪作為國內最早使用redis,並且是國內最大的redis使用者,當然備受人們關注。新浪微博中一項很重要數據,計數類業務就用到了Redis。OK ...

Tue May 06 00:28:00 CST 2014 4 2295
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M